Job Summary
The Drexel University Kline School of Law’s Center for Law and Transformational Technology invites applications for a two-year postdoctoral fellow, beginning September 1, 2022, with an emphasis on sociotechnical research in the areas of law, regulation, and governance at the intersection of law and technology, and the development of new technologies. Applicants from all disciplines and methodological approaches are welcome to apply. The Center for Law and Transformational Technology was created in 2021 with a seed grant from the Green Family Foundation to bring together key stakeholders, including legal and technological scholars, industry leaders, activists, regulators, and other experts from across the country and the world. The Center supports concrete efforts to gauge the legal impact of transformational technology, promote critical conversations about the role of law in technological change and bring legal experts into interdisciplinary conversations with researchers and developers at all stages of design and development. Working across industries, the Center helps educate lawyers to play a positive role navigating a technological landscape we cannot yet imagine. By facilitating international and multi-disciplinary partnerships, the Center seeks to contribute to a future in which technology moves forward hand-in-hand with society.
The Fellow will also have the opportunity to collaborate with faculty and participate in workshops and symposia from across the University. Situated in the heart of Philadelphia, Kline Law and the Center for Law and Transformational Technology offer exciting opportunities to engage with the region’s intellectual and innovation communities.
Essential Functions
The Fellow will work with law faculty and faculty in cognate disciplines who work with the Center. The Fellow is expected to conduct original research, teach at least one class each year (for JD students or undergraduates studying in the Law School’s newly established B.A. in Law program), and support Center activities including symposia, outreach to scholars in varied disciplines, and a student research fellow program. The Fellow is expected to participate fully in the intellectual life of the Center and of Kline Law.
